Ingredients
For the Roasted Cauliflower
- 1 large head of cauliflower: Choose a firm, white head of cauliflower, free from blemishes. A large head will yield approximately 6-8 cups of florets, perfect for this recipe. Cauliflower forms the hearty base of our wrap, offering a satisfying bite and a wealth of nutrients.
- 2 tablespoons olive oil: Extra virgin olive oil is recommended for its flavor and health benefits. It helps the cauliflower roast beautifully, adding a subtle richness and preventing it from drying out. You can substitute with avocado oil or coconut oil if preferred.
- 1 teaspoon chili powder: This provides a foundational warmth and subtle spice to the cauliflower. Ensure your chili powder is fresh for the best flavor. For a milder flavor, you can reduce the amount slightly, or for extra heat, use a spicier chili powder blend.
- 1/2 teaspoon cumin: Ground cumin adds an earthy and smoky depth that complements the chili powder and cauliflower perfectly. It enhances the overall savory profile of the roasted vegetables.
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der: Garlic powder provides a convenient way to infuse the cauliflower with a savory garlic flavor. If you prefer fresh garlic, you can substitute with 2 cloves of minced garlic added to the cauliflower along with the olive oil.
- 1/4 teaspoon salt: Salt is crucial for seasoning and enhancing the flavors of the cauliflower and other spices. Use sea salt or kosher salt for best results; adjust to taste.
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per: Freshly ground black pepper adds a subtle bite and complexity to the roasted cauliflower.
For the Chickpea Filling
- 2 (15-ounce) cans chickpeas, rinsed and drained: Chickpeas are the protein powerhouse of this wrap, adding substance and creamy texture. Rinsing removes excess sodium improving flavor; cooking your own chickpeas from dried is also an option.
- 1/4 cup red onion, finely diced: Red onion provides sharpness that balances creaminess in chickpeas while adding crunch. Finely dicing ensures even distribution in mixtures.
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ped: Fresh cilantro brings vibrant citrusy flavor essential to chili-lime profile; use fresh as dried wonβt provide same taste.
- Juice of 2 limes: Fresh lime juice adds zestiness that brightens dish; always use fresh limes when possible.
- 1 tablespoon olive oil: Helps coat chickpeas while softening red onions slightly.
- 1 tablespoon chili sauce (like Sriracha or Gochujang): Offers significant kick; adjust based on spice tolerance.
- 1 teaspoon chili powder: Reinforces chili flavor in chickpeas providing another layer warmth.
- 1/2 teaspoon cumin: Mirrors spice in cauliflower creating cohesive flavor throughout wrap.
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der: Enhances savory notes tying into roasted cauliflowerβs flavors.
- 1/4 teaspoon salt: Balances acidity from lime juice against heat from chili sauce.
For the Avocado Crema
- 1 ripe avocado: Crucial for creamy texture; ensure itβs soft but not mushy; adds healthy fats balancing spices.
- 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t (or vegan alternative): Adds tanginess lightening crema compared to just using avocado; substitutes include sour cream or cashew yogurt options available too.
- Juice of 1/2 lime: Brightens crema preventing browning while complementing flavors within wraps beautifully.
- 2 tablespoons water (or more): Helps thin crema achieving desired consistency; adjust as needed based on preference thickness required.
- 1/4 teaspoon salt: Seasons crema enhancing overall flavorβadjust as necessary based on tastes.
For Wrapping
- 4 large tortillas or wraps: Choose according preferenceβwhole wheat adds fiber while spinach offers color/flavorβensure size can hold all fillings comfortably.

How to Make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ap Recipe
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 425Β°F (220Β°C). This high temperature will help achieve perfect roasting results on both cauliflower florets and chickpeas.
Step 2: Prepare Cauliflower Florets
- Remove leaves from the head of cauliflower. Cut it into small florets ensuring uniformity in size which promotes even cooking during roasting.
Step 3: Season Cauliflower
In a mixing bowl:
* Combine cauliflower florets with olive oil, ch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, salt & black pepper until evenly coated.
Step 4: Roast Cauliflower
Spread seasoned florets onto baking sheet:
* Roast in preheated oven for about 25β30 minutes or until golden brown flipping halfway through cooking time until tender yet still firm enough texture remains intact.
Step 5: Prepare Chickpea Mixture
In another bowl:
* Mix drained/rinsed chickpeas along with red onion,c cilantro,lime juice & olive oil then add chili sauce followed by remaining spices stirring gently until fully combined ensuring even distribution throughout mixture.
Step 6: Make Avocado Crema
In food processor:
* Blend ripe avocado,yogurt,lime juice & water together until smooth forming luscious creamy consistency adjusting thickness if needed by adding more water as desiredβseason lightly with salt accordingly!
Step 7: Assemble Wraps
Lay out tortilla/wraps flat:
* Layer roasted cauliflowers first followed by chickpea mixture then drizzle over avocado cremaβadd optional toppings before folding tightly into wraps ensuring fillings stay intact!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store your leftover wraps in an airtight container.
- They will stay fresh for about 3-4 days in the refrigerator, making them great for meal prep.
Freezing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ap Recipe
- Wrap individual portions t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e bag.
- These wraps can be frozen for up to 3 months.
Reheating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ap Recipe
-
Bold phrase: Oven β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Place the wraps on a baking sheet and heat for about 10-15 minutes until warmed through.
-
Bold phrase: Microwave β Place a wrap on a microwave-safe plate and cover with a damp paper towel. Heat for 1-2 minutes or until hot, checking periodically.
-
Bold phrase: Stovetop β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at, add a little oil if desired, and warm the wrap for about 5 minutes on each side until heated through.
Frequently Asked Questions
If you have questions about the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ap Recipe, youβre not alone! Here are some frequently asked queries:
Can I use other beans instead of chickpeas?
Yes! You can substitute with black beans or kidney beans, depending on your preference. Just ensure theyβre well-drained and rinsed.
How spicy is this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ap Recipe?
The spice level depends on your choice of chili powder and sauce. Start with less if you prefer mild heat, and adjust according to your taste.
What other vegetables can I add?
Feel free to incorporate bell peppers, spinach, or zucchini into the filling for added nutrition and flavor!
How do I make this wrap vegan?
Simply replace plain Greek yogurt with a vegan alternative like cashew yogurt or coconut yogurt for the crema.

Chili Lime Chickpea Cauliflower Wrap

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: Serves 4
- Category: Main
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
Ingredients
- 1 large head of cauliflower
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1/2 teaspoon cumin
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 2 (15-ounce) cans chickpeas, rinsed and drained
- 1/4 cup red onion, finely diced
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
- Juice of 2 limes
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on chili sauce
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1/2 teaspoon cumin
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 ripe avocado
- 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t (or vegan alternative)
- Juice of 1/2 lime
- 2 tablespoons water (or more)
- 4 large tortillas
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 425Β°F (220Β°C).
- Cut the cauliflower into small florets and toss with olive oil, chili powder, cumin,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Roast the cauliflower on a baking sheet for about 25β30 minutes until golden brown.
- In a bowl, combine drained chickpeas, red onion, cilantro, lime juice, olive oil, chili sauce, and spices.
- For the avocado crema, blend avocado, Greek yogurt (or vegan alternative), lime juice, water, and salt until smooth.
- Assemble wraps by layering roasted cauliflower and chickpea mixture on tortillas. Drizzle with avocado crema and add optional toppings before rolling tightly.
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 serving
- Calories: 360
- Sugar: 5g
- Sodium: 400mg
- Fat: 15g
- Saturated Fat: 2g
- Unsaturated Fat: 13g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 49g
- Fiber: 12g
- Protein: 12g
- Cholesterol: 0mg
